Whether Mini Bernedoodles are good family dogs is a common question. Short answer – YES
I’ll include some AI response below, but, in our experience, the Bernedoodle is a great family pet. They are ferociously loyal, love to lay on the couch, yet have some bounce in their step to play outside. Very well rounded and love to be by you and included in your everyday life – we love them (which is good since we’re around them so much 🙂 )
As far as intelligence, while not the sharpest tool in the shed like the Aussiedoodle, who, given enough time and coaching could probably write this blog post, the Bernedoodle does not fall into the ‘box of rocks’ category like a Pug (we had a couple Pugs in days gone by). They can keep up. I probably mis-assign less intelligence attribute to their slightly goofy personalities at times, so maybe I’m wrong and they are secret evil geniuses plotting their takeover.

Friendly and Affectionate Temperament
Mini Bernedoodles are known for their loving and people-oriented personalities.
They typically:
- form strong bonds with their families
- enjoy being around people
- thrive on attention and interaction
Because of this, they do best in homes where they are part of everyday life.
This makes them a great match for families who want an engaged, loyal companion.
Great With Kids
One of the biggest reasons families choose Mini Bernedoodles is how well they interact with children.
They are generally:
- gentle
- patient
- playful
Their size also makes them more manageable around younger kids compared to larger breeds.
As with any dog, early socialization and supervision help ensure safe, positive interactions.
Highly Intelligent and Trainable
Mini Bernedoodles are very smart thanks to their Poodle lineage.
This means they:
- pick up commands quickly
- respond well to positive reinforcement
- are suitable for first-time dog owners
With consistent training, they can become well-mannered and adaptable family pets.
Moderate Energy, Adaptable Lifestyle
Mini Bernedoodles have a balanced energy level.
They enjoy:
- daily walks
- playtime
- outdoor activity
But they’re also happy to relax at home once their exercise needs are met.
This makes them a great fit for both active families and more relaxed households.
Things to Consider Before Choosing a Mini Bernedoodle
While they make excellent family dogs, there are a few things to keep in mind:
- Grooming needs – regular brushing and professional grooming
- Social needs – they prefer not to be left alone for long periods
- Training consistency – early training is important
Understanding these factors helps ensure a great long-term match.
